2027 conspiracy: Will national security be sacrificed as Ruto faces North in vote hunt?

President William Ruto addressing Wananchi during the laying of the foundation stone for the Isiolo County Aggregation and Industrial Park and addressed residents of Isiolo Town on February 07, 2025. [PSC]

As President William Ruto ran across North Eastern Kenya in the ended week, questions lingered on population issues, altruism, the 2027 presidential election, and Somali nationalism in Kenya, and in the greater Somali community in Eastern Africa.

Was the tour about redressing historical injustices against the Somali of Kenya or did it seek to open the floodgates for foreigners to shoo up Ruto's electoral numbers? Was it Dr Ruto's answer to a wider Kenyan nation where he is steadily becoming unpopular? Why was the President often erupting into violent language?
